고랭(Golang) 언어란?
고랭(Golang)은 구글이 개발한 오픈 소스 프로그래밍 언어로, 간결하고 성능이 우수하며 병행성(Concurrency)을 지원하는 특징을 가지고 있습니다. 이 언어는 정적 타입(statically typed)이며 가비지 컬렉션(Garbage Collection) 기능을 통해 메모리 관리를 자동으로 수행합니다. 고랭은 컴파일 언어로 빠른 실행 속도를 자랑하며 파이썬과 유사한 문법을 가지고 있어 쉽게 학습할 수 있습니다. 또한, 다양한 오픈 소스 라이브러리와 풍부한 개발자 커뮤니티가 있어서 빠르고 안정적인 어플리케이션을 개발할 수 있습니다. 고랭은 웹 개발, 클라우드 네이티브 애플리케이션, 분산 시스템, 머신러닝 등 다양한 분야에서 활용되고 있습니다. 결론적으로 고랭은 현대적인 어플리케이션을 개발하기에 매우 효율적이고 강력한 언어입니다.
학습을 위한 준비
학습을 위한 준비는 성공적인 학습을 위해 매우 중요합니다. 학습을 시작하기 전에는 환경을 정리하고 집중할 수 있는 조용한 장소를 찾는 것이 좋습니다. 또한, 공부할 내용에 대한 목표를 설정하고 학습 계획을 세우는 것도 중요합니다. 목표를 세움으로써 학습에 대한 동기부여를 높일 수 있습니다. 또한, 필요한 교재나 학습 도구들을 미리 준비해 두는 것도 도움이 될 것입니다. 학습을 시작하기 전에 몸과 마음을 편안히 하고 집중력을 높일 수 있는 방법을 찾아 실천하는 것도 좋은 전략입니다. 이러한 준비를 통해 효과적인 학습을 할 수 있을 것입니다.
고랭(Golang)의 특징과 장점
고랭(Golang)은 구글에서 개발한 프로그래밍 언어로, 강력한 툴과 라이브러리를 제공하여 개발자들이 효율적으로 소프트웨어를 개발할 수 있게 해준다. 이 언어는 특히 병렬처리 기능이 강력하여 대규모 시스템에서 뛰어난 성능을 발휘한다. 간결하고 명확한 문법을 가지고 있어 학습 곡선이 낮고 생산성이 높다. 또한 고성능 네트워크 프로그램을 쉽게 개발할 수 있어 웹 서버나 분산 시스템에 적합하다. 또한 고랭은 정적 타입 언어로 컴파일 시간 오류를 줄여주어 안정적인 소프트웨어를 만들 수 있게 해준다. 이러한 이유로 고랭은 현재 빠르게 성장하는 프로그래밍 언어 중 하나이며, 다양한 분야에서 활용되고 있다.
실전 프로젝트 개발
실전 프로젝트 개발은 개발자들 사이에서 매우 중요한 주제입니다. 실전 경험은 이론적인 지식을 실제로 적용하여 문제를 해결하고 제품을 만들어내는 과정을 의미합니다. 프로젝트 개발은 단순히 코딩 능력만을 요구하는 것이 아닌, 팀원과의 협업, 일정 관리, 문제 해결 능력 등 다양한 역량을 요구합니다.
실전 프로젝트를 개발하면서 주의해야 할 점은 사용자의 요구를 충분히 분석하고, 목표를 명확하게 설정하는 것입니다. 또한, 개발하는 동안 주기적인 피드백과 소통을 통해 프로젝트를 지속적으로 향상시켜야 합니다. 이를 통해 사용자들에게 더 나은 서비스를 제공할 수 있을 뿐만 아니라, 개인의 역량도 향상시킬 수 있습니다.
실전 프로젝트 개발은 개발자로서의 경력을 쌓는 데 있어서 중요한 마일스톤이 될 수 있습니다. 새로운 기술을 배우고 적용하는 과정에서 여러 어려움에 부딪히겠지만, 그것이 개발자로 성장하는 과정이기도 합니다. 따라서, 실전 프로젝트 개발을 통해 새로운 도전에 대한 열정을 유지하고, 끊임없는 자기계발을 추구하는 것이 중요합니다.